通常,SQL 文件中的语句会以分号(;)结尾。这是 MySQL 默认的命令分隔符。 如果你的 SQL 文件使用了不同的命令分隔符(例如\G用于垂直显示结果),请确保文件内容正确。 编码: 确保SQL 文件的编码与 MySQL 客户端的编码一致,以避免字符集问题。 通过SOURCE命令,你可以方便地将复杂的 SQL 脚本应用到你的数据库中,...
mysql> SOURCE /path/to/database.sql; 1. 请将/path/to/database.sql替换为你的sql文件的路径。 执行SOURCE命令后,Mysql将会读取并执行sql文件中的每一条sql语句,包括数据库的结构定义和数据插入语句。在执行过程中,系统会输出每一个被执行的sql语句,并显示执行结果。 完整代码示例 $ mysqldump-uusername-p-...
第一步,打开sheel命令窗口,进入数据库 mysql -u用户名 -p 输入密码 第二步,切换数据库 mysql>use test; (其中test为要导入的数据库名) 第三步,导入sql文件 mysql> source /root/pro_sql/test.sql (source后边为sql文件存放位置) 操作完以上步骤,等待命令运行完成即可 例子...
### 基础概念 `source`命令是MySQL中的一种客户端命令,用于执行SQL脚本文件。它允许你将一系列SQL语句从文件中读取并执行,通常用于批量执行数据库操作,如数据导入、表结构创建等。 ...
当你在执行 SQL 文件之前,确保文件中的字符不会因为字符集不匹配而出现乱码。 示例 假设你有一个包含 Unicode 字符的 SQL 文件,并希望确保数据正确插入到数据库中,可以在执行source命令之前运行以下命令: SET NAMES utf8mb4; source /路径/到/你的/sql文件.sql; ...
常用source 命令 进入mysql数据库控制台, 如mysql -u root -p mysql>use 数据库 然后使用source命令,后面参数为脚本文件(如这里用到的.sql) mysql>source d:/wcnc_db.sql mysqldump支持下列选项: –add-locks 在每个表导出之前增加LOCK TABLES并且之后UNLOCK TABLE。(为了使得更快地插入到MySQL)。
source 是MySQL 命令行工具中的一个命令,用于执行 SQL 脚本文件。通过 source 命令,可以一次性执行 SQL 文件中的多条 SQL 语句,从而快速完成数据库的初始化、数据导入或其他批量操作。 相关优势 批量操作:通过单个命令即可执行多个 SQL 语句,提高效率。 脚本化:便于维护和管理,特别是在需要重复执行相同数据库操作时...
MySQL的SOURCE命令用于执行一个包含SQL语句的文件。要正确使用SOURCE命令,可以按照以下步骤操作:1. 打开MySQL命令行客户端,输入用户名和密码登录到MySQL数据库。2. ...
假设有一个名为sampledb的数据库和一个包含建表和插入数据的SQL文件sampledb.sql,在Windows环境下,操作步骤如下: 1. 打开命令提示符,输入mysqlu root p登录MySQL。 (图片来源网络,侵删) 2. 输入密码后,使用命令use sampledb;选择数据库。 3. 使用命令source C:/path/to/sampledb.sql;执行SQL文件中的命令。